Transaction 8ca15cf8034e17638229ae45f3996a3be90f07adb61688c4eb968aab2344c07c
1 Input
1 Output
-
8ca15cf8034e17638229ae45f3996a3be90f07adb61688c4eb968aab2344c07c:0
- value
- 1229129
- script pubkey
- OP_0 OP_PUSHBYTES_20 e80774bd1263bc16ff56ebd9e49a9a5e9b8c426f
- address
- bc1qaqrhf0gjvw7pdl6ka0v7fx56t6dccsn0ya8rmr